{"_id":"passthru","_rev":"24-a3abfbe52cf845eb34843c826aa1361e","name":"passthru","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","dist-tags":{"latest":"0.4.0"},"versions":{"0.0.1":{"name":"passthru","version":"0.0.1","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repositories":{"type":"git","url":"https://github.com/laggyluke/node-passthru.git"},"engines":{"node":">0.2","npm":"~1"},"_npmJsonOpts":{"file":"/home/vagrant/.npm/passthru/0.0.1/package/package.json","wscript":false,"contributors":false,"serverjs":false},"_id":"passthru@0.0.1","dependencies":{},"devDependencies":{},"_engineSupported":true,"_npmVersion":"1.0.15","_nodeVersion":"v0.4.9","_defaultsLoaded":true,"dist":{"shasum":"655e3988ade65ddefcec433a73d09c776b396497","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.0.1.tgz","integrity":"sha512-7ef0U7GAZZ0pqLgVEiA5EXRmphvVOIu3U1LslS+BNhmB3YkClqA9kfoQOtSrRrEeW9H96rZkwgrER8YFjem3jQ==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IBfeiDMUjO8nzrSUtePnP6Hv/5pg59QR7EynoHkHvKHTAiEAtvmkKkRAdgtRTFtTTCI8qal1qlraeKEeF7ifUt0uPds="}]},"scripts":{}},"0.0.2":{"name":"passthru","version":"0.0.2","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repositories":{"type":"git","url":"https://github.com/laggyluke/node-passthru.git"},"engines":{"node":">0.2","npm":"~1"},"_npmJsonOpts":{"file":"/home/vagrant/.npm/passthru/0.0.2/package/package.json","wscript":false,"contributors":false,"serverjs":false},"_id":"passthru@0.0.2","dependencies":{},"devDependencies":{},"_engineSupported":true,"_npmVersion":"1.0.15","_nodeVersion":"v0.4.9","_defaultsLoaded":true,"dist":{"shasum":"345239e89d997a8fdc470243cafdff81cf6568f4","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.0.2.tgz","integrity":"sha512-iE3jtKpo6WkwkpLXGcu/1mf0cOFygLngpU8Z1NXXgHk2iQxHuV+jSRhDi/8RHY1wvXtsxtwhfT01Xg6PHU5QJg==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IQDaCRKFq7LwuPc6C680EEJd7QhK/pkjsQj0Zqdb68IiAwIgbsIJZIH5ZNqI7LifeZay0xlhWRNFAWydSCQqUwB2KAI="}]},"scripts":{}},"0.0.3":{"name":"passthru","version":"0.0.3","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"git://github.com/laggyluke/node-passthru.git"},"engines":{"node":">0.2","npm":"~1"},"_npmJsonOpts":{"file":"/home/vagrant/.npm/passthru/0.0.3/package/package.json","wscript":false,"contributors":false,"serverjs":false},"_id":"passthru@0.0.3","dependencies":{},"devDependencies":{},"_engineSupported":true,"_npmVersion":"1.0.15","_nodeVersion":"v0.4.9","_defaultsLoaded":true,"dist":{"shasum":"4e0e531f24c98d74efad4c46dd3f6f53bac672eb","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.0.3.tgz","integrity":"sha512-EKcnAnQKqOzq9gbX7nBxacwUcU7a8OKi9ufSmv6mXi6fGjYeBvF6sGVClIhuBpNUGLPJPtjxWU4LqtnZECKnMg==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IQCwjYN0qEdsrufiQoVqO7e/lC1jXtmKGCJYJfNjPPtAGwIgCnjoi5oHh0vaS7WKR1acA+mW69FcNFndXGHSdEzLzEE="}]},"scripts":{}},"0.0.4":{"name":"passthru","version":"0.0.4","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"git://github.com/laggyluke/node-passthru.git"},"engines":{"node":">0.2","npm":"~1"},"_npmJsonOpts":{"file":"/Users/laggyluke/.npm/passthru/0.0.4/package/package.json","wscript":false,"contributors":false,"serverjs":false},"_id":"passthru@0.0.4","dependencies":{},"devDependencies":{},"_engineSupported":true,"_npmVersion":"1.0.27","_nodeVersion":"v0.4.10","_defaultsLoaded":true,"dist":{"shasum":"2a99a27cb2fd4a3e8449602a04ab201c72f0510f","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.0.4.tgz","integrity":"sha512-hFR56DJ/EfuzN/jU9OCml2Jeg131As50uDehf3qVMRdJrA3pLDO0nVZ++SCazTa8k+6/xr224jz89oLLelbiMQ==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EQCIDcIVPqEq+sGIhVm/7Jr0g5OyQsM7TfvzqxT2qJRTyDkAiByyhys9CSuEBzHxlA6or2E8rEXQE9Rz3duW/EvO7DpcQ=="}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.0.5":{"name":"passthru","version":"0.0.5","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"git://github.com/laggyluke/node-passthru.git"},"engines":{"node":"0.6.x"},"_npmUser":{"name":"laggyluke","email":"george.miroshnykov@gmail.com"},"_id":"passthru@0.0.5","dependencies":{},"devDependencies":{},"_engineSupported":true,"_npmVersion":"1.1.0-beta-4","_nodeVersion":"v0.6.6","_defaultsLoaded":true,"dist":{"shasum":"39d2a7aa3256435a45590fc2d6253e2dd1210800","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.0.5.tgz","integrity":"sha512-j7BjM0mnTCAM7vCGhIBVajTCO1pTCkDCWOe8wYAJ9POJw6Izepdn7G176gTczl6nS4TIhlm87sTqor2O22CeTQ==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EYCIQDXAiEORrYxl2Xq+7a3hnHoedCJIcKdP1GpzRN8KcBSvQIhAIhevO1vw7XwlxIRUnG9sHhJ4uIKgc/wFRSjQIuxBPaW"}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.1.0":{"name":"passthru","version":"0.1.0","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"git://github.com/laggyluke/node-passthru.git"},"engines":{"node":"0.6.x"},"_npmUser":{"name":"laggyluke","email":"george.miroshnykov@gmail.com"},"_id":"passthru@0.1.0","dependencies":{},"devDependencies":{},"optionalDependencies":{},"_engineSupported":true,"_npmVersion":"1.1.12","_nodeVersion":"v0.6.14","_defaultsLoaded":true,"dist":{"shasum":"bedf1eb1060d75dff59d2ce15baa9dda9e400f72","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.1.0.tgz","integrity":"sha512-Zv+yew47/s22Vep3HlQNq04RRRJTwUE5YSVscVeX+g+Z83tBLvp9mP1dDoLlSA5TT7w9mkd+XqKi2kOEW/Oy+w==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EYCIQCEm5ds1SdK5h0w6dtVu2pVJNK1g/VNorQNpf+4D7ye+wIhAIZT8E2qk0lDZp5Vc8p5eGlqFQ+k5ifCssAGmFz265a4"}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.2.0":{"name":"passthru","version":"0.2.0","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"git://github.com/laggyluke/node-passthru.git"},"engines":{"node":"0.6.x"},"_npmUser":{"name":"laggyluke","email":"george.miroshnykov@gmail.com"},"_id":"passthru@0.2.0","dependencies":{},"devDependencies":{},"optionalDependencies":{},"_engineSupported":true,"_npmVersion":"1.1.12","_nodeVersion":"v0.6.14","_defaultsLoaded":true,"dist":{"shasum":"878147bba0daca5b7cda1dacf192af099ed4d56b","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.2.0.tgz","integrity":"sha512-JaQ4zTpuIYFMOVVxnwLrZ8TL5y+T41s5YMnn1k+UNsPLIFwhHmMCsZ+hzo3n5gLK+mNIEB4VdgaAy4/K0kr4+g==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EYCIQDu8M1LnRM+EZe4wX18bBDuAmGWAODNCScJqhps+ZKhFAIhAJ7qfC8e9f2J5vBNstoRx0ZEPTShBp39csJFnhPb770U"}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.2.1":{"name":"passthru","version":"0.2.1","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"git://github.com/laggyluke/node-passthru.git"},"engines":{"node":"0.6.x"},"scripts":{"test":"test/test.sh"},"_npmUser":{"name":"laggyluke","email":"george.miroshnykov@gmail.com"},"_id":"passthru@0.2.1","dependencies":{},"devDependencies":{},"optionalDependencies":{},"_engineSupported":true,"_npmVersion":"1.1.12","_nodeVersion":"v0.6.14","_defaultsLoaded":true,"dist":{"shasum":"ddc369dc05e75a601370dd88059d3ffe7e72334c","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.2.1.tgz","integrity":"sha512-//5HOHtpTOv6CQW3D/9oTTBjeREVmFiWaZjQutR/re4AmwBAbajpgMkkIdwE7+9Plmelmlt13dIwZiRkjjDGtQ==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IFFm9HqW9WNqm8dBVmY0q38cjdKLiPAdQXJruGCgH+iCAiEAghKVUTYdumkbZPSBhqwcTLQ1jaJNH4/Oypv9SDYKDXQ="}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.2.2":{"name":"passthru","version":"0.2.2","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"https://github.com/laggyluke/node-passthru.git"},"engines":{"node":"0.6 - 0.8"},"scripts":{"test":"test/test.sh"},"_id":"passthru@0.2.2","dist":{"shasum":"de803591772b2cc242253e34b26bfb57a396393d","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.2.2.tgz","integrity":"sha512-Vns/WEcuVIvSoYnWcgq/D3132BPjZh723PseBq3FaWAsQ4JqgsmmEWan6XJImk4OfNSEd8qopt4wzcI+7va/hg==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IQDa7n66yfm5iwS/fsGvzLnZdJYBTBAJ7wP6SJV8hkAH+gIgdXNKZPZi6aIiwSfAvULosZKKNBVqqYKBQOAP8+N4rv4="}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.3.0":{"name":"passthru","version":"0.3.0","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","main":"index","repository":{"type":"git","url":"https://github.com/laggyluke/node-passthru.git"},"engines":{"node":"0.8"},"scripts":{"test":"test/test.sh"},"_id":"passthru@0.3.0","dist":{"shasum":"fafe9df6ffa205199c0ca28ee6ea9002f8b00c28","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.3.0.tgz","integrity":"sha512-a6aOjSMP+ZPhsGdIuYz4ep0fEauR+WKdR1hScCXvl2APHlW2pNy1yxQVudThDtWEsMvJJjq+BorW3X7X8lA4+A==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EUCIQDauypziIoO/n065t/snvLA7tVBN0Wx2ZMhji4/37brPQIgX+XR70kxSEi4bx36NMGRCvP5jA7FyyBQYzqCGcT+yp0="}]},"_from":".","_npmVersion":"1.2.2","_npmUser":{"name":"laggyluke","email":"george.miroshnykov@gmail.com"},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]},"0.4.0":{"name":"passthru","version":"0.4.0","description":"Spawns a child process attached to parent's stdin, stdout and stderr. Inspired by PHP's passthru().","keywords":["passthru","spawn","child_process"],"homepage":"https://github.com/laggyluke/node-passthru","license":"MIT","main":"index","repository":{"type":"git","url":"https://github.com/laggyluke/node-passthru.git"},"engines":{"node":">= 0.8"},"scripts":{"test":"test/test.sh"},"gitHead":"46e5ef3ccd47371102cd8bdab1aa71430ebd8342","bugs":{"url":"https://github.com/laggyluke/node-passthru/issues"},"_id":"passthru@0.4.0","_shasum":"135f03acca35721f196e8c6ac96f49d1deae2fb8","_from":".","_npmVersion":"2.7.5","_nodeVersion":"0.12.2","_npmUser":{"name":"laggyluke","email":"george.miroshnykov@gmail.com"},"dist":{"shasum":"135f03acca35721f196e8c6ac96f49d1deae2fb8","tarball":"https://registry.npmjs.org/passthru/-/passthru-0.4.0.tgz","integrity":"sha512-FyztJunkiO9qpHUbAaxkHtSOjQLPdT7dt/nlnEcEgDiNOHJNYHYMc9EkqA2DVdfxLtqRe8W2FWQ0OMqRRgwDlA==","signatures":[{"keyid":"SHA256:jl3bwswu80PjjokCgh0o2w5c2U4LhQAE57gj9cz1kzA","sig":"MEYCIQDItlRNo/Ox9EdLZVUaEyiVkaODuQh+c/1ZNe/ePBMZ3AIhALMSGUktOV9DZcxvLpf8HHZuFYe/+FPVBDWeiBnfcquP"}]},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}]}},"maintainers":[{"name":"laggyluke","email":"george.miroshnykov@gmail.com"}],"time":{"modified":"2022-06-23T13:55:34.873Z","created":"2011-07-08T21:47:48.123Z","0.0.1":"2011-07-08T21:47:49.848Z","0.0.2":"2011-07-08T22:39:46.557Z","0.0.3":"2011-07-08T22:52:33.175Z","0.0.4":"2011-09-03T10:30:25.497Z","0.0.5":"2012-01-05T17:38:21.548Z","0.1.0":"2012-03-26T10:15:57.494Z","0.2.0":"2012-03-27T07:57:08.922Z","0.2.1":"2012-04-08T17:28:27.842Z","0.2.2":"2012-06-25T21:21:44.225Z","0.3.0":"2013-01-24T20:57:17.352Z","0.4.0":"2015-04-18T08:34:16.376Z"},"repository":{"type":"git","url":"https://github.com/laggyluke/node-passthru.git"},"readme":"node-passthru\n=============\n\nSpawns a child process attached to parent's stdin, stdout and stderr.\nInspired by PHP's passthru().\n\n[![Build Status](https://secure.travis-ci.org/laggyluke/node-passthru.png)](http://travis-ci.org/laggyluke/node-passthru)\n\nUsage\n-----\n\n    passthru(command, [options], [callback]);\n\nFor example, do an `ls -la` in the current directory:\n\n    var passthru = require('passthru');\n    passthru('ls -la', function(err) {\n        // ...\n    });\n\nYou can also pass command as an array of strings.\nThis is mandatory for arguments containing spaces and other special characters.\n\n    passthru(['ls', '-la'], function(err) {\n        // ...\n    });\n\nYou can use any options supported by `child_process.spawn`:\n\n    passthru('ls -la', {cwd: '/tmp'}, function(err) {\n        // ...\n    });\n","homepage":"https://github.com/laggyluke/node-passthru","keywords":["passthru","spawn","child_process"],"bugs":{"url":"https://github.com/laggyluke/node-passthru/issues"},"license":"MIT","readmeFilename":"README.md"}